Monitoring a Storm Cluster

Hello everyone,

I wanted to ask if there any configuration for a Strom cluster in order 
to get notifications (via mail ?) when a worker node goes down (or the 
connection the zookeeper ? ).

I have been using storm for quite a while and managed to make my 
production topology quite stable but still have some minor craches on 
the worker nodes at some times.

Checking the Storm UI is a solution but does not offer immediate 
notifications by itself.

Re: Monitoring a Storm Cluster

Posted by Danijel Schiavuzzi <da...@schiavuzzi.com>.
You could try Monit, it's a process supervisor with additional system
monitoring and alerting features. It can alert you by e-mail on Supervisor
and Nimbus crashes and any other metrics you setup it to monitor. I believe
you could configure it to monitor Storm's Worker processes too.
